Que es un sistema de nombre de dominio

Que es un sistema de nombre de dominio

En el vasto mundo de Internet, donde millones de usuarios navegan diariamente, es fundamental entender cómo se organizan y localizan las páginas web. Uno de los pilares tecnológicos que permite esta navegación es el sistema de nombre de dominio, un mecanismo esencial que facilita la conexión entre los humanos y las máquinas. Este sistema, conocido como DNS (Domain Name System), es el encargado de traducir los nombres de dominio, como por ejemplo *www.ejemplo.com*, en direcciones IP que las computadoras pueden entender y procesar. En este artículo exploraremos en profundidad qué es un sistema de nombre de dominio, cómo funciona y su importancia en el ecosistema digital.

¿Qué es un sistema de nombre de dominio?

Un sistema de nombre de dominio, o DNS, es una infraestructura tecnológica que permite la traducción de nombres de dominio legibles para los usuarios a direcciones IP numéricas. Estas direcciones son utilizadas por las computadoras para localizar y comunicarse con los servidores donde se alojan las páginas web. Por ejemplo, cuando un usuario escribe *www.google.com* en su navegador, el sistema DNS se encarga de encontrar la dirección IP correspondiente, como *172.217.160.78*, y redirigir la solicitud al servidor correcto.

El DNS actúa como un directorio telefónico digital. En lugar de recordar una secuencia de números, los usuarios pueden usar nombres de dominio fáciles de memorizar. Este sistema está organizado en una jerarquía descentralizada, con servidores de raíz, servidores TLD (Top-Level Domains) y servidores de dominio específicos que trabajan en conjunto para resolver consultas de manera rápida y eficiente.

Un dato interesante es que el primer registro DNS se creó en 1983, cuando el sistema se implementó oficialmente en ARPANET, el precursor de Internet. Desde entonces, el sistema ha evolucionado para manejar el crecimiento exponencial del número de dominios registrados en todo el mundo.

También te puede interesar

Efecto del dominio medio que es

El efecto del dominio medio es un fenómeno psicológico que estudia cómo los individuos toman decisiones en contextos donde están expuestos a estímulos ambiguos o con múltiples interpretaciones. Este efecto, también conocido como efecto de contexto intermedio, se refiere a...

Que es servicio de dominio

En el mundo digital, el servicio de dominio es una pieza clave para que cualquier sitio web pueda existir en internet. Este proceso permite que los usuarios accedan a una página web mediante una dirección fácil de recordar, en lugar...

Que es la disciplina del dominio personal

La disciplina del dominio personal es un concepto que muchas personas buscan entender para mejorar su vida diaria, alcanzar metas y desarrollar hábitos positivos. En esencia, se trata de la capacidad de controlar uno mismo, sus impulsos, emociones y acciones,...

Qué es el dominio de aplicaciones web

En el mundo digital, los términos técnicos pueden parecer complejos, pero con una explicación clara se vuelven comprensibles. Uno de estos conceptos es el dominio de aplicaciones web, es decir, la dirección única que permite a los usuarios acceder a...

Qué es un dominio con sus textos

Un dominio, también conocido como nombre de dominio, es una dirección única en Internet que se utiliza para identificar y localizar un sitio web específico. Es el equivalente al nombre de una casa en una calle, donde los usuarios pueden...

Que es dominio en las matemáticas

En el mundo de las matemáticas, uno de los conceptos fundamentales que se estudia desde los primeros niveles educativos es el de *dominio*. Este término, aunque sencillo, tiene una importancia crucial en el análisis de funciones, ya que define el...

El funcionamiento detrás de la conexión digital

El funcionamiento del sistema de nombre de dominio se basa en una red de servidores distribuida globalmente. Cuando un usuario solicita un sitio web, su computadora primero consulta un servidor DNS local, que puede estar proporcionado por su proveedor de Internet. Si este servidor no tiene la información almacenada, la solicitud se pasa a los servidores de raíz, que indican a qué servidor TLD (como .com, .net o .org) se debe dirigir.

Una vez que se identifica el servidor TLD, se consulta al servidor de autoridad del dominio específico. Por ejemplo, si se busca *www.ejemplo.com*, el servidor de autoridad de *ejemplo.com* proporciona la dirección IP del servidor web donde se almacena el sitio. Finalmente, esta información se devuelve al navegador del usuario, que puede entonces establecer una conexión y mostrar el contenido solicitado.

Este proceso ocurre en milisegundos y es invisible para el usuario final. Gracias al sistema DNS, millones de personas pueden navegar por Internet sin necesidad de recordar cientos de direcciones IP. Además, el DNS permite la redirección de tráfico, balanceo de carga y gestión de registros de correo, entre otras funciones esenciales.

Aspectos técnicos del sistema DNS

Dentro del sistema DNS, existen diferentes tipos de registros que permiten almacenar información específica sobre cada dominio. Algunos de los registros más comunes incluyen:

  • A Record: Asocia un nombre de dominio con una dirección IPv4.
  • AAAA Record: Hace lo mismo, pero para direcciones IPv6.
  • CNAME Record: Crea un alias para un nombre de dominio.
  • MX Record: Indica los servidores de correo asociados al dominio.
  • TXT Record: Almacena información de texto, como verificaciones de dominio o configuraciones de SPF.

Estos registros son configurados en los servidores DNS del dominio y son esenciales para el correcto funcionamiento de las páginas web, los correos electrónicos y otros servicios en línea. Además, el sistema DNS utiliza protocolos como UDP y TCP para comunicarse entre servidores y clientes, garantizando que la información se transmita de manera segura y eficiente.

Ejemplos prácticos del sistema DNS

Para entender mejor cómo funciona el sistema de nombre de dominio, veamos un ejemplo concreto. Supongamos que un usuario quiere visitar *www.wikipedia.org*. Cuando escribe esta URL en su navegador:

  • El navegador consulta un servidor DNS local para obtener la dirección IP de *www.wikipedia.org*.
  • Si el servidor DNS no tiene la información, la solicitud se pasa a los servidores de raíz.
  • Los servidores de raíz redirigen la consulta a los servidores TLD responsables del dominio .org.
  • Los servidores TLD a su vez redirigen la consulta a los servidores de autoridad de *wikipedia.org*.
  • Estos servidores devuelven la dirección IP del servidor web donde se almacena el sitio.
  • Finalmente, el navegador utiliza esa dirección IP para cargar la página web.

Este proceso, aunque aparentemente invisible, es lo que permite que millones de personas accedan a información en línea de manera rápida y sin inconvenientes. Otro ejemplo práctico es el uso de correos electrónicos. Cuando se envía un correo a *usuario@ejemplo.com*, el sistema DNS consulta los registros MX para determinar a qué servidor de correo debe entregarse el mensaje.

El concepto de jerarquía en el DNS

Una de las características más importantes del sistema de nombre de dominio es su estructura jerárquica. Esta jerarquía se divide en varias capas, comenzando por los servidores de raíz, que son los primeros en recibir las consultas de los usuarios. A continuación, se encuentran los servidores TLD, responsables de los dominios de primer nivel como .com, .net, .org, entre otros.

Por debajo de los TLD, están los servidores de dominio específicos, que gestionan los subdominios y los registros de los usuarios. Por ejemplo, en *www.ejemplo.com*, el servidor de autoridad de *ejemplo.com* es el que proporciona la información necesaria para resolver la consulta. Esta jerarquía permite que el sistema sea escalable y que cada nivel tenga una función clara y específica.

Además, el DNS utiliza un sistema de nombres invertidos, donde los dominios se escriben de derecha a izquierda. Esto significa que *www.ejemplo.com* se interpreta como *ejemplo.com* dentro del TLD .com. Esta estructura jerárquica es fundamental para garantizar que las consultas se resuelvan de manera eficiente y sin ambigüedades.

Recopilación de los principales componentes del sistema DNS

El sistema DNS está compuesto por varios elementos clave que trabajan en conjunto para garantizar su funcionamiento:

  • Servidores de raíz: 13 servidores distribuidos globalmente que son los primeros en recibir las consultas DNS.
  • Servidores TLD: Responsables de los dominios de primer nivel, como .com, .net, .org, entre otros.
  • Servidores de autoridad: Gestionan los registros de los dominios específicos, como *ejemplo.com*.
  • Servidores DNS locales: Operados por ISPs o empresas, son los primeros en recibir las consultas de los usuarios.
  • Caché DNS: Almacena temporalmente las respuestas a consultas previas para agilizar futuras búsquedas.
  • Resolutores DNS: Software o dispositivos que realizan las consultas DNS en nombre de los usuarios.

Cada uno de estos componentes desempeña una función esencial en el proceso de resolución de nombres. Sin la colaboración entre ellos, el sistema DNS no podría funcionar de manera eficiente, lo que afectaría la conectividad y el acceso a Internet en todo el mundo.

La importancia del DNS en la conectividad global

El sistema de nombre de dominio no solo facilita la navegación web, sino que también es esencial para el funcionamiento de múltiples servicios digitales. Desde el envío de correos electrónicos hasta la conexión a redes sociales, el DNS está presente en cada interacción en línea. Además, su capacidad para manejar grandes volúmenes de tráfico y su diseño distribuido le permiten soportar a miles de millones de usuarios sin interrupciones.

Otra ventaja importante del sistema DNS es su flexibilidad. Permite que los servidores web se redirijan fácilmente a diferentes ubicaciones geográficas, lo que mejora la velocidad de carga de las páginas y reduce la latencia. Esto es especialmente útil para empresas con presencia global, que pueden optimizar la experiencia del usuario según su ubicación. Además, el DNS también permite la implementación de políticas de seguridad, como la protección contra phishing y el bloqueo de sitios maliciosos.

¿Para qué sirve el sistema de nombre de dominio?

El sistema de nombre de dominio tiene múltiples funciones que van más allá de la traducción de nombres a direcciones IP. Algunas de sus principales utilidades incluyen:

  • Navegación web: Permite que los usuarios accedan a páginas web sin necesidad de recordar direcciones IP.
  • Gestión de correos electrónicos: A través de los registros MX, el DNS asegura que los correos lleguen a los servidores correctos.
  • Balanceo de carga: Permite distribuir el tráfico entre múltiples servidores para mejorar el rendimiento.
  • Redirección: Facilita el uso de alias y subdominios para organizar el tráfico web de manera eficiente.
  • Seguridad: A través de protocolos como DNSSEC, el sistema DNS puede proteger contra ataques de suplantación de identidad y envenenamiento de caché.

En resumen, el sistema DNS es una herramienta fundamental para el funcionamiento de Internet, ya que no solo facilita el acceso a información, sino que también garantiza la seguridad y la eficiencia en la comunicación digital.

Sinónimos y variantes del sistema de nombre de dominio

Existen varias formas de referirse al sistema de nombre de dominio, dependiendo del contexto técnico o del nivel de detalle que se requiera. Algunas de las variantes más comunes incluyen:

  • DNS (Domain Name System): El nombre técnico más utilizado en el ámbito de la informática.
  • Sistema de resolución de nombres: Un término más general que describe el proceso de traducción de nombres a direcciones IP.
  • Servicio de nombres de dominio: Se usa con frecuencia en contextos empresariales y administrativos.
  • Directorio de nombres de dominio: Un término menos común, pero que resalta la función de búsqueda y localización del sistema.

Aunque estos términos pueden variar ligeramente en su uso, todos se refieren al mismo concepto fundamental: un sistema que permite la conexión entre los usuarios y los recursos en Internet a través de nombres fáciles de recordar.

El papel del DNS en la gestión de dominios

La gestión de dominios es una tarea que implica el registro, configuración y actualización de los registros DNS asociados a un nombre de dominio. Cualquier persona que desee crear un sitio web o un servicio en línea debe registrarse un dominio y configurar correctamente sus registros DNS. Esto incluye definir los servidores A, CNAME, MX y otros registros según las necesidades del proyecto.

Muchos proveedores de dominios ofrecen herramientas de gestión DNS que permiten a los usuarios modificar fácilmente los registros desde una interfaz web. Estas herramientas son esenciales para garantizar que los sitios web, los correos electrónicos y otros servicios funcionen correctamente. Además, algunos proveedores ofrecen servicios de DNS premium con características avanzadas, como la migración de dominios, el monitoreo de disponibilidad y la protección contra ataques DDoS.

El significado del sistema de nombre de dominio

El sistema de nombre de dominio no es solo un mecanismo técnico, sino una infraestructura que define cómo se organizan y acceden a los recursos en Internet. Su importancia radica en la capacidad de traducir nombres legibles a direcciones numéricas, lo que permite que los usuarios naveguen por la red de manera intuitiva. Sin el DNS, la experiencia de Internet sería mucho más complicada, ya que los usuarios tendrían que recordar cientos de direcciones IP para acceder a sus sitios favoritos.

Además, el DNS es una herramienta clave para la administración de Internet, ya que permite la gestión de recursos, la seguridad y la escalabilidad del sistema. Es un ejemplo de cómo la tecnología puede facilitar la interacción entre los humanos y las máquinas, convirtiendo lo complejo en algo accesible para todos.

¿Cuál es el origen del sistema de nombre de dominio?

El origen del sistema de nombre de dominio se remonta al año 1983, cuando el ingeniero Paul Mockapetris propuso el desarrollo de un sistema para gestionar los nombres de los hosts en ARPANET, el precursor de Internet. El objetivo era crear un directorio distribuido que permitiera a los usuarios acceder a los recursos de la red sin necesidad de recordar direcciones IP.

La implementación del DNS se basó en una estructura jerárquica, donde los nombres se organizaban de manera inversa, comenzando por el TLD y terminando por el nombre del host. Esta estructura permitió la expansión del sistema y la gestión de millones de dominios en todo el mundo. A lo largo de los años, el DNS ha evolucionado para adaptarse a las nuevas demandas de Internet, incluyendo la introducción de IPv6 y el desarrollo de protocolos de seguridad como DNSSEC.

Sinónimos y términos relacionados con el sistema DNS

A lo largo de este artículo, hemos utilizado varios términos relacionados con el sistema de nombre de dominio. Algunos de ellos incluyen:

  • Resolución DNS: Proceso mediante el cual se traduce un nombre de dominio a una dirección IP.
  • Servidor DNS: Cualquier servidor que participe en el proceso de resolución de nombres.
  • Proveedor de DNS: Empresa o servicio que ofrece resolución DNS a usuarios y empresas.
  • Registro DNS: Cada uno de los datos almacenados en los servidores DNS, como A, CNAME, MX, etc.
  • DNSSEC: Protocolo de seguridad que protege contra la manipulación de registros DNS.

Estos términos son esenciales para comprender el funcionamiento del sistema DNS y su papel en la conectividad digital. Aunque pueden parecer técnicos, todos ellos forman parte de un ecosistema que garantiza que Internet sea accesible, seguro y eficiente para todos los usuarios.

¿Cómo se configura el sistema de nombre de dominio?

Configurar el sistema de nombre de dominio implica varios pasos que deben seguirse con precisión para garantizar que los registros se almacenen correctamente y los servicios funcionen como se espera. Los pasos básicos incluyen:

  • Registro del dominio: Se elige un nombre de dominio y se registra a través de un proveedor de dominios.
  • Seleccionar servidores DNS: Se eligen los servidores DNS que gestionarán los registros del dominio.
  • Configurar los registros: Se crean los registros A, CNAME, MX, TXT, etc., según las necesidades del sitio web o servicio.
  • Validar la configuración: Se utilizan herramientas como el comando *nslookup* o *dig* para verificar que los registros se resuelvan correctamente.
  • Monitorear y actualizar: Se revisa periódicamente la configuración para asegurar que los registros estén actualizados y funcionen sin errores.

El proceso puede variar según el proveedor de dominios y los servicios que se deseen configurar, pero los principios básicos son los mismos. Una configuración adecuada del sistema DNS es esencial para el correcto funcionamiento de cualquier sitio web o servicio digital.

Cómo usar el sistema de nombre de dominio y ejemplos de uso

El sistema de nombre de dominio es una herramienta que, aunque invisible para el usuario final, está presente en cada interacción en línea. Para usarlo de forma efectiva, es importante entender cómo se configuran los registros y cómo se gestionan los servidores DNS. A continuación, se presentan algunos ejemplos de uso:

  • Configuración de un sitio web: Al registrar un dominio, se deben configurar los registros A y CNAME para apuntar a los servidores donde se aloja el sitio.
  • Configuración de correos electrónicos: Los registros MX deben configurarse correctamente para que los correos lleguen al servidor de correo adecuado.
  • Uso de subdominios: Se pueden crear subdominios como *blog.ejemplo.com* o *tienda.ejemplo.com* para organizar diferentes servicios bajo un mismo dominio.
  • Monitoreo de disponibilidad: Los proveedores de DNS ofrecen herramientas para monitorear la disponibilidad del sitio y notificar en caso de caídas o errores.
  • Protección contra ataques DDoS: Algunos proveedores de DNS ofrecen servicios de protección contra ataques masivos que intentan colapsar un sitio web.

Estos ejemplos muestran la versatilidad del sistema DNS y su importancia en la gestión de recursos en Internet. Aunque su funcionamiento puede parecer complejo, con la ayuda de herramientas adecuadas, su uso se vuelve accesible para cualquier usuario que desee gestionar un sitio web o servicio digital.

El impacto del DNS en la ciberseguridad

El sistema de nombre de dominio no solo facilita la navegación web, sino que también juega un papel crucial en la ciberseguridad. Debido a su función de redirección de tráfico, el DNS es un punto estratégico que puede ser aprovechado tanto por usuarios legítimos como por actores maliciosos. Para mitigar este riesgo, se han desarrollado protocolos y tecnologías de seguridad específicas para el DNS.

Uno de los protocolos más importantes es el DNSSEC (DNS Security Extensions), que añade una capa de autenticidad y integridad a los registros DNS, evitando que se manipulen o se intercepten. Otra medida de seguridad es el filtrado DNS, que permite bloquear el acceso a sitios web maliciosos o no deseados, ofreciendo una protección adicional a los usuarios.

Además, el uso de DNS privado o DNS cifrado (como DNS over HTTPS o DNS over TLS) ayuda a proteger la privacidad del usuario al ocultar las consultas DNS de terceros. Estas tecnologías son especialmente útiles para usuarios que valoran la privacidad y la seguridad en línea, especialmente en redes públicas o inseguras.

El futuro del sistema DNS

El sistema de nombre de dominio está en constante evolución para adaptarse a las nuevas demandas de Internet. Con el crecimiento del número de dispositivos conectados, el auge del IPv6 y la necesidad de mayor seguridad, el DNS debe seguir innovando para mantener su relevancia. Algunas de las tendencias futuras incluyen:

  • Mayor adopcación de IPv6: Con la escasez de direcciones IPv4, el sistema DNS debe gestionar con eficacia las direcciones IPv6.
  • Integración con el Internet de las Cosas (IoT): El DNS debe ser capaz de gestionar millones de dispositivos conectados, lo que exige mayor escalabilidad.
  • Uso de inteligencia artificial: Algunas empresas están explorando el uso de la IA para optimizar la resolución de nombres y predecir fallos.
  • Mayor enfoque en la privacidad: Con el aumento de la conciencia sobre la protección de datos, el DNS debe garantizar que las consultas no puedan ser rastreadas o interceptadas.

El futuro del sistema DNS dependerá de su capacidad para adaptarse a estos retos y aprovechar las oportunidades que ofrecen las nuevas tecnologías. Su evolución será fundamental para garantizar que Internet siga siendo un lugar seguro, accesible y eficiente para todos los usuarios.